Sarajevo City and Gymnasium Obala Are Helping to Restore Roof of National Museum

Published: February 14, 2014
Share
SHARE

historijski_muzej_bihThe Deputy Mayor of Sarajevo Dr. Ranko Čović will participate in an exhibition today at 11:00 on celebrating Vučko’s birthday in the B&H National Museum.

The student council of Gymnasium Obala, with students from other Sarajevo schools, gathered artifacts form the Winter Olympic Games 1984, which will be available to the public from 14 February to 25 February 2014.

Sarajevo City will buy 500 tickets in the amount of 1.000 BAM, which will be divided to students of high school and elementary school, in order to encourage young people to visit museums, theatres and exhibitions. Revenues from this project will be invested for the restoration of the roof of the National Museum.

The idea of this student project is that, in addition to marking this important event in the history of Sarajevo, to draw attention on the importance of cultural institutions and their role in the promotion of the cultural and historical heritage of B&H.
